Re: Tired of paying for new items & receiving used or QVC returns

I was a manufacturers rep for many years.  I am sure QVC isn't any different.  The manufactirer or designer is back billed for the defective and or returns.  Defective is usually destroyed and thrown away so it can't be resold or that dumpster divers can't find them and return them.  Returns due to size issues are usually sold at a reduced price but clearly marked as not a new item. So for QVC theu would be sold "as is" online or sent to the outlet stores.  Selling returns or used items is a deceptive.
